Summary
The speaker emphasizes the importance of commitment from sponsors in podcast advertising and highlights a non-negotiable insertion order document that ensures prepayment. The document also acts as a litmus test for sponsor commitment.

Summary
The benefits of paperback publishing used to vary for both the author and consumer, but it seems that those benefits may no longer exist as paperbacks now provide only marginal to non-existent benefits to readers and authors alike. Paperback royalties only pay an author 50% of what they're currently earning per book, which means they'll need to sell twice as many copies to earn the same amount as before, while the cost savings to consumers have also dwindled.
